Boosie Badazz Has yet Again Found Himself in the Midst of Gun Violence

This occurred after gunfire erupted on the set of a video Boosie Badazz was filming. A video clip shows Boosie encircled by his crew while rapping to “Clutchin’.” Gunshots are heard before the video breaks off. Boosie is safe and was not harmed during the incident.

It’s impossible to tell where the shots came from since everyone on set was holding guns. One person was gravely hurt. The victim has been identified as 20-year-old Randall Strong Jr., who later succumbed to the injuries.
Complex reports that Christopher Kwan Freeman, 22, was arrested and charged with murder by the Huntsville Police Department. According to the police, a confrontation between the two sparked the incident. After combing the neighborhood for him, Freeman eventually turned himself in on Sunday.

Boosie later took to Twitter where he posted:

“AINT NOBODY TRY TO KILL ME N HUNTSVILLE AL. YALL MFS BE HAPPY TO SPREAD LIES ON ME #LOL”
A shooting that occurred last year left Boosie Badazz requiring two operations. According to reports, Boosie was shot in Big T’s Plaza, a strip mall. He was taken to a nearby hospital for treatment but refused to help with the police inquiry.
Boosie performed in a wheelchair while recuperating from the leg injury.
